Obstacles for Those who work with a Foreign Market

According to ListGlobally's study, there are some common hurdles that real estate agents face in foreign markets. A language barrier is an obvious obstacle, accounting for 37% of responses in our study, followed by building a relationship with clients (13%) and funding issues (13%).

Looking more specifically at the respondent results: language is still the main obstacle, gathering 43% of responses, as is building a relationship with clients (14%).   However, we also find a significant mention of cultural differences & lifestyle (29%) as an obstacle.

Advice from Real Estate Agents

Our study on how to work with foreign buyers, showed some helpful tips: 

1. Understand local market nuances

The advice of Laurie Laykish from Engel & Volkers is relevant.  When you work with foreign buyers, you need to remain persistent and you must increase your local market knowledge.

Start by learning about currency Issues, laws, the local political situation, cross cultural relationships and world conditions. Then, prepare yourself for potential questions that your customers might have. Some of the most important topics you need to address are the cost of living, education opportunities, the healthcare system, You will also need to understand the required documents and you need to be the real MacGyver of tax system.

After addressing these questions, you just need to sell them the dream and help clients imagine living in one of your properties.

 

2. Be patient and respect cultural differences

According to Climb Real Estate agents, in order to succeed globally you need to be patient and respect cultural differences. Empathy, understanding and active listening are skills that dictate the success of an international agent.

We know that selling a property to a Chinese citizen differs from selling to a Brazilian citizen. Take time to read cultural guides. We, at ListGlobally, suggest the Commisceo, as a good resource.

 

3. Learn more about international investors and procedures

According to Century 21 agent Mr. Osmondi, to be successful in the international market, you must learn about foreign investors and international procedures. Conducting a complete diagnosis of your buyer is quite helpful and may include: what they expect in a village or city, what are the most important features to them and their budget.

While working with foreign buyers, it is also important to build a network all around the globe. Partnering with other real estate agents that are in the country of your potential customers is very important. By establishing partnerships, you will be able to rapidly increase your cultural knowledge. Remember that when a customer is recommended by another agent in the origin country, the probability of selling to that person is higher.
